@pi-alexander-popel suggests that pnpm workspaces are not behaving stably with our packages, thus we'll use simple npm workspaces. @YaroslavVlasenko our goal here is to make sure all packages build, tests and release as before. They used a remote_package.json mechanism which was a redundant copy of package.json, just because node could not release more than 1 package from a single repository, with npm workspaces this should be solved.
